What Is SSL Email?
SSL email uses Secure Sockets Layer encryption to protect data and communications during transfer over the internet. The purpose of SSL is to establish an encrypted connection between an email client and a server or between a web server and a browser. Emails sent and received through your account are protected by this encryption, making it impossible for unauthorized parties to access or intercept the data.
SSL encrypts email data as it travels from your client (like Thunderbird, Gmail, or Outlook) to the email hosting server and the recipient’s incoming mail server and inbox. The goal is to ensure an email’s integrity and confidentiality while it’s transmitted so the information remains safe if intercepted.
It is worth mentioning that SSL is an older protocol. Many systems have moved to using Transport Layer Security (TLS), a more modern, secure version. Despite this, SSL is still commonly used as a general term for data encryption for websites and emails.

What is SSL Email vs Non-SSL Email?
Security is the primary difference between SSL and non-SSL emails. Anybody who intercepts an email can see its contents because non-SSL emails send data in plaintext. This leaves private data vulnerable to online threats such as phishing, data theft, and eavesdropping.
SSL email, on the other hand, encrypts the data before transmission, guaranteeing that unauthorized parties cannot access it. Avoid using non-SSL email as it poses a serious security risk, particularly when sending sensitive data.

How Does SSL Email Work?
SSL encrypts data as it travels between your email client and the email server to ensure that only the intended recipient can view it. This is a summary of how SSL email functions:
Handshake Process
When you send an email, the email client starts a “handshake” with the email server. The server provides a digital certificate during this handshake; this verifies its identity and includes the public key required for encryption.
The Connection is Encrypted
Following a successful handshake, SSL or TLS encrypts the connection between your email client and the server. This means that all sent data, including the email body, attachments, and login information, gets jumbled into ciphertext, rendering it unintelligible to anyone trying to intercept it.
Decryption at the Recipient’s End
Only the intended recipient can view the email after it has been delivered, as the receiver’s email server or client uses a private key to decrypt the contents. This procedure guarantees email will stay safe and unreadable even if intercepted during transmission.

How To Enable SSL For Your Email Account
One of the most important steps in protecting your emails is to enable SSL. Depending on the email client or platform you’re using, the steps for enabling it can vary, but for widely used services, the general procedures are as follows:
Enabling SSL on Outlook
- Open Outlook and go to Account Settings.
- Select your email account and click More Settings.
- Under Advanced, enable SSL for both incoming and outgoing mail servers.
- Save the settings and restart Outlook to apply the changes.
Enabling SSL on Gmail
SSL/TLS encryption is enabled by default for your email communications if you use Gmail with a browser.
If using Gmail with a third-party email client (such as Outlook or Thunderbird), ensure SSL/TLS is enabled in the account settings for incoming and outgoing mail.
Enabling SSL on Apple Mail
- Open Mail and go to Preferences.
- Select Accounts and choose your email account.
- Under Advanced, enable SSL for the mail server settings.
- Restart the application to apply the changes.
Setting Up SSL on Your Mail Server
Ensuring SSL is set up correctly is essential if you control your email server. This involves setting up your server to use SSL/TLS for all incoming and outgoing connections. You must purchase and install an SSL certificate from a reliable Certificate Authority (CA).

Common Issues with SSL Email And How to Troubleshoot Them
1. SSL Certificate Errors
These issues happen when the email server’s SSL certificate is misconfigured, expired, or untrusted. Ensure you have a valid SSL certificate installed and updated to fix the issue. If you need help, contact your email service or hosting company.
2. Expired SSL Certificates
An expired SSL certificate will cause errors or warnings when sending or receiving emails. Renewing the SSL certificate before its expiration will resolve this. SSL certificate renewals are offered automatically by many hosting companies.
3. Domain Mismatch or Protocol Errors
Errors can occur if the SSL certificate’s domain does not match the domain of your email server or if the incorrect protocol is being used (for example, SSL 3.0 rather than TLS). Ensure the most recent security standards are installed on your email client and server.
4. Connection Timeout Issues
A firewall or antivirus program can prevent your email client from establishing a secure connection to the server. Check your firewall settings to verify port 465 for SSL or port 587 for TLS is open for outgoing mail.
